WebAloe Vera plants prefer 55-80°F (13-27°C). They can withstand short cold periods, but continuous exposure to temperatures below 50°F (10°C) may kill the plant. To promote growth, prune and divide. If your Aloe Vera plant is growing congested, split it by separating the pups and repotting them. Web30 de mar. de 2024 · Typically, potted aloe vera plants should be watered at least once per week. This watering frequency provides enough moisture to keep the plant thriving during the warm growing seasons of spring and summer. Too much water can cause a top-heavy aloe plant with bending and drooping leaves. Web29 de abr. de 2024 · Keep the plant away from drafty doors or vents, especially in the winter.
